About Judith West
Judith West is a scholar working on Surgery, Rehabilitation,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Occupational Therapy, having authored 11 papers that have together received 778 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Wound Healing and Treatments (4 papers), Diagnosis and Treatment of Venous Diseases (3 papers), Diabetic Foot Ulcer Assessment and Management (3 papers), Estrogen and related hormone effects (1 paper), Surgical site infection prevention (1 paper),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(1 paper), Species Distribution and Climate Change (1 paper) and Phase-change materials and chalcogenides (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Rehabilitation (204 citations), Occupational Therapy (95 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(56 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(152 citations) and Surgery (294 citations). Judith West has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Harriet W. Hopf, Thomas K. Hunt, J. Arthur Jensen, William H. Goodson, Heinz Scheuenstuhl, Kent Jönsson, Alison McKenzie, Nancy N. Byl, Andrea Kurz and Daniel I. Sessler.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of Surgery, Wound Repair and Regeneration, The Clinical Teacher, Translational Behavioral Medicine and Cancer Epidemiology Biomarkers & Prevention.
